Why Is Shooting Ear Protection Essential for Your Hearing Safety?

Shooting ear protection is essential for your hearing safety because firearms produce loud noises that can damage hearing. Exposure to sounds over 85 decibels can lead to permanent hearing loss. Proper ear protection reduces the sound intensity that reaches your ears, helping to prevent injury.

According to the Centers for Disease Control and Prevention (CDC), noise-induced hearing loss occurs when exposure to loud sounds damages the delicate hair cells in the inner ear. These hair cells play a crucial role in transmitting sound signals to the brain. When they are damaged, hearing can be permanently affected.

The underlying reasons for needing shooting ear protection are rooted in the physics of sound. Firearms can produce sounds ranging from 140 to 190 decibels upon firing. Such high-decibel sounds can lead to immediate and irreversible damage to hearing. This damage occurs because intense sound waves can cause trauma to the auditory system, often leading to a condition known as tinnitus, where individuals hear ringing or buzzing sounds without external stimuli.

Decibel levels measure sound intensity, and sounds above 85 decibels can damage hearing with prolonged exposure. The inner ear can be injured when these sound levels are encountered regularly. Hearing protection devices (HPDs) like earplugs and earmuffs are designed to attenuate sound waves, meaning they reduce the volume that reaches the inner ear.

Specific conditions that exacerbate noise-induced hearing loss include extended periods of shooting without ear protection. For example, competitive shooters may be exposed to multiple gunshots in a single session, increasing their risk. Additionally, persons with pre-existing hearing conditions may find their susceptibility heightened. Regular exposure to gunfire without adequate ear protection can lead to cumulative damage, resulting in profound and permanent hearing loss.

How Important Is the Noise Reduction Rating (NRR) in Choosing Ear Protection?

The Noise Reduction Rating (NRR) is crucial in choosing ear protection. It measures how effectively hearing protection reduces noise levels. A higher NRR indicates greater sound attenuation. This ensures that the wearer can protect their hearing during loud activities, such as shooting, construction, or motorsports.

When selecting ear protection, consider these components: sound exposure levels, required protection, and comfort. Evaluate the noise level of the environment. Identify the NRR required to reduce sound exposure to safe levels. Comfort is also essential, as prolonged use of ear protection must be bearable.

Choose ear protection with an appropriate NRR for your specific needs. For example, if you are often exposed to sounds above 85 decibels, select gear with a higher NRR, ideally above 25. This will help shield your ears effectively. Additionally, consider fit and comfort to ensure the protection is worn consistently.

Overall, the NRR plays a significant role in preserving hearing safety. Understanding the relationship between noise exposure, NRR, and comfort helps in making informed decisions about ear protection.

What Materials Provide the Best Comfort and Effectiveness in Shooting Ear Protection?

The materials that provide the best comfort and effectiveness in shooting ear protection include foam, silicone, and custom-molded options.

  1. Foam Earplugs
  2. Silicone Earplugs
  3. Custom-Molded Earplugs
  4. Earmuffs with Noise Reduction Ratings (NRR)

Foam earplugs are made from soft, compressible material that helps to fill the ear canal. The American Speech-Language-Hearing Association notes that foam earplugs can reduce noise levels significantly when properly fitted. They are lightweight and often disposable, making them convenient for occasional shooting. However, some users find them less comfortable for extended wear.

Silicone earplugs are another option. They are more durable and reusable than foam. Many users prefer silicone for its ability to provide a good seal without feeling as intrusive. The Sound Advice document by the Minnesota Department of Natural Resources highlights that silicone earplugs can be very effective in reducing harmful noise levels while allowing for some ambient sound perception. However, they may not fit all ear shapes equally well.

Custom-molded earplugs are designed specifically for the individual’s ear shape. These plugs often offer superior comfort and noise reduction. According to a study by the National Institute for Occupational Safety and Health (NIOSH), custom earplugs provide better sound isolation and can be worn comfortably for extended periods. The cost and the process required to obtain them may deter some users.

Earmuffs with Noise Reduction Ratings (NRR) are another effective shooting ear protection option. These devices fit over the ears and contain passive and active noise-cancelling features. According to the CDC, earmuffs typically provide a higher NRR than earplugs. They can be a preferred choice for shooters who may also need to communicate while on the range, as many models allow for ambient sound amplification. However, some users may find earmuffs bulkier and less suitable for wearing with other headgear.

Each type of ear protection has its advantages and limitations. Users may choose based on personal comfort, effectiveness, and specific shooting environment needs.

What Are the Main Types of Shooting Ear Protection Available on the Market?

The main types of shooting ear protection available on the market include electronic ear protection, passive ear protection, and custom-molded ear protection.

  1. Electronic ear protection
  2. Passive ear protection
  3. Custom-molded ear protection

The differences among these types of ear protection reflect the needs and preferences of different users, such as sport shooters versus hunters, and their specific environmental conditions and auditory concerns.

  1. Electronic Ear Protection:
    Electronic ear protection actively amplifies ambient sounds while providing noise reduction during loud gunfire. This type offers convenience for conversations and hearing commands on the shooting range. According to a 2021 review by the Journal of Safety Research, these devices can reduce harmful noise levels while allowing normal conversation at safe decibel levels when not in use. Common features include adjustable volume settings and microphones that pick up surrounding sounds.

  2. Passive Ear Protection:
    Passive ear protection includes earmuffs and earplugs that entirely block sound without the use of electronics. These devices prevent sound waves from reaching the ear and are typically more affordable. Research by the National Institute for Occupational Safety and Health (NIOSH) shows that passive devices can provide sufficient noise reduction for many shooting scenarios. These options are often recommended for shooters who operate in consistently loud environments or prefer a more straightforward protection method.

  3. Custom-Molded Ear Protection:
    Custom-molded ear protection is made to fit the unique shape of an individual’s ear, providing a snug and secure fit that can enhance comfort and protection. A study from the Audiology Research Journal indicates that these devices offer superior noise isolation compared to standard earplugs. Additionally, these custom molds often incorporate filters that balance sound attenuation while allowing for safe auditory input, making them popular among professional shooters and those with specific hearing needs.

What Are the Potential Risks of Not Using Proper Hearing Protection While Shooting?

The potential risks of not using proper hearing protection while shooting include permanent hearing loss, tinnitus, psychological stress, and reduced situational awareness.

  1. Permanent hearing loss
  2. Tinnitus
  3. Psychological stress
  4. Reduced situational awareness

Not using proper hearing protection exposes individuals to various physical and psychological risks.

  1. Permanent Hearing Loss: Not using proper hearing protection leads to permanent hearing loss. This occurs due to exposure to loud noise, particularly gunfire, which can reach levels above 140 decibels. According to the Centers for Disease Control and Prevention (CDC), sounds above 85 decibels can cause hearing damage, especially with repeated exposure. A study by the American Speech-Language-Hearing Association (ASHA) found that sustained exposure to gunshot noise is a leading cause of irreversible hearing damage in shooters and those near gunfire.

  2. Tinnitus: Tinnitus is characterized by ringing or noise in the ears resulting from noise exposure. It can be an immediate effect after shooting or develop over time. The National Institute on Deafness and Other Communication Disorders (NIDCD) states that prolonged exposure to loud noises can cause changes in the auditory system, resulting in tinnitus. Many shooters report having this condition due to frequent shooting without proper ear protection.

  3. Psychological Stress: The absence of hearing protection can lead to increased psychological stress. Loud noises can trigger anxiety and stress reactions in individuals. A study conducted by the Journal of Occupational and Environmental Medicine suggests that exposure to high noise levels can elevate stress hormones, contributing to mental health issues. Individuals may experience heightened anxiety or fear related to potential hearing loss or damage after shooting in unprotected environments.

  4. Reduced Situational Awareness: Not wearing hearing protection can diminish situational awareness. Loud gunfire can mask other important sounds, like commands or warning signals from others nearby. This can result in dangerous situations in shooting ranges or during competitive shooting events. A study published in the Journal of Experimental Psychology noted that individuals exposed to high levels of noise displayed slower reaction times and decreased performance in tasks requiring situational awareness. Such issues can compromise safety and performance for shooters.
